Matthew Shilling Obituary

Obituary published on Legacy.com by Craddock Funeral Home on Mar. 9, 2026.
Funeral services for Matthew Hawley Shilling will be at 1:00 pm Friday, March 13, 2026, in the Craddock Memorial Chapel with Dr. David Daniel officiating. Burial will follow at Hillcrest Cemetery with David Shilling, Allen Knippers, Rob Waybright, Brent Roady, Joe Phillips, and B. J. Bostick assisting as pallbearers.

Matthew was born Monday May 31, 1982, in Ardmore, Oklahoma to Tom and Revonda (Hawley) Shilling and passed away Sunday March 8, 2026, in Mustang, Oklahoma at the age of 43 years, 9 months and 8 days.

Matthew was Valedictorian of the Plainview High School Class of 2000. He was a National Merit Scholar and honored as an Academic All-Stater. He continued his education and graduated from the University of Oklahoma in 2004 with bachelor's in computer science. After college he worked as a software developer in the transaction processing and aviation industries. As a technology enthusiast, he enjoyed programming even outside of work, building homemade audio devices, 3-D printing, and video games. He was generous with his affinity for technology and regularly helped friends and family with all sorts of tech issues. Matthew was at his best tackling difficult, complex problems that required an extreme depth of analysis to complete. He would seek out such problems on his own, whether at work or as a hobby. Once he had an interesting, difficult problem to work on, Matthew was unable to let go of it and relentlessly pursued a solution. He enjoyed playing card and board games with his close friends and took pride in chaining together complicated plays that stretched the rulebooks to the limit.

Matthew was an avid reader, including fantasy and science fiction, non-fiction history and autobiographies, and classic literature. He made a point to schedule times to read during his day, and his disciplined approach helped him read multiple books simultaneously. He enjoyed particularly dense works that necessitated copious notes, dictionaries, and references to fully appreciate. He possessed a quick wit and knack for clever catchphrases and wordplay. However, he often abused this talent to create terrible puns, to his delight and to the groans of his friends and family.

Matthew listened to music, but particularly enjoyed repeated listens to fully pick out and appreciate all aspects of songs and albums. He also enjoyed listening to specific artists' work in chronological order to understand the artists' changing styles. He enjoyed drawing pictures of characters, action sequences, and landscapes on his tablet. His favorite sports teams to root for were the Oklahoma Sooners and San Antonio Spurs.

Matthew was preceded in death by his grandparents, Kenneth Shilling, Elizabeth Shilling, and Harlene Hawley. He is survived by his parents, Tom and Revonda Shilling, brother, David Shilling, and grandfather, Ortrey Hawley.
